An opening try in the 11th minute by new signing Netani Talei was scored from a quick ball from the 5m line from a turnover in the ruck. The conversion was missed by their fly half James Brown.
A break from Hala'ufia saw the offload taken by Will Skinner in support, with a 2 on 1, Ugo Monye took the ball over the line. Conversion was from Malone, taking the Quins ahead.
A kick and chase from Danny Care saw Garvey penalized for holding onto the ball, and Malone converted. 10-5.
In the 27th minute, after a high tackle from Hala'ufia, referee Chris White showed a yellow card, and Quins were reduced to 14 men.
The resulting penalty saw James Brown put 3 points on the Worcester score.
With 34 minutes gone on the clock, Quins gave away a penalty, which they kicked to touch. From the line out the ball was driven forward and taken over the line by Worcester number 2, Aleki Lutui. Worcester changed their kicker, and the conversion was sealed by Loki Crichton.
Quins came back to full strength with Hala'ufia returning to the field, with 3 minutes on the clock. Worcester were penalized and from the penalty, Quins chose to kick to touch, and from the lineout Danny Care took the ball, sent it to the blind side for Ugo Monye to score his second try of the match. The try was converted by Malone. 17-15.
In the last kick of the first half, Crichton kicked a penalty and put Worcester ahead going into the break with the score line 17-18.
At the beginning of the second half both teams spent a good 15 minutes in each other's halves with no points to show for their efforts.
A yellow card was shown to Marcel Garvey for deliberate hands in the ruck and Worcester were down to 14 men. Harlequins took advantage of the extra man and quick hands down from the line out saw Mike Brown take a wide pass from Hal Luscombe and go over in the corner. Malone missed the conversion. 22-18.
After a flood of substitutions from Worcester, their revitalized pack came back and captain Pat Sanderson touched down in the 71st minute. 22-23.
Even though Quins placed pressure on Worcester in the dying minutes, Worcester were relieved when Ugo Monye was penalized for holding on to the ball and kicked the ball into touch. The final whistle followed shortly.
